The present invention pertains to the field of electronics and essentially relates to a method that involves selecting semantic units of recognisable originals comprising n constitutive elements. The method further involves separating in the selections made the sets of fragments to be checked and comprising n1 elements, carrying out a search in an auxiliary data block comprising semantic units which have an imprecision level epsilon and are different from the separated sets of fragments, finding in the recognised semantic units the elements that do not correspond to their equivalent symbols as for their location in the semantic units found during the search process, and substituting them with the symbols from the found semantic units that correspond to them as for the location. The method finally involves forming an additional block of dynamic raster references in the composition of the recognised semantic units and in an amount of n7, and converting the auxiliary data block until the imprecision level epsilon 3 is reduced relative to the imprecision level epsilon 1 and lies within a range of 1 </= ( epsilon 1 + epsilon 3) / epsilon 1 </= 2. |
